中钇富铕稀土矿萃取分离前水解除铝研究
Removing of Aluminum from Leaching Solution of Yttrium-medium and Europium-rich Mineral by Using Hydrolysis Method
【摘要】 对中钇富铕离子稀土矿萃取分离前的料液,用水解法除铝,进行了pH、稀土浓度、温度、陈化时间等条件的除铝实验,测定出这些条件下Al(OH)3的沉淀反应商(Q)及部分Ksp[Al(OH)3]值。实验的Al去除率最大为97%,表明精矿溶解料直接用水解法除铝可行。与萃取法除铝相比,该方法简单,不需增加设施,成本低。
【Abstract】 By using hydrolysis method,aluminum ion in leaching solution of yttrium-medium and europium-rich mineral can be largely removed before extraction separation process.The reaction quotient Q value and Kspvalue of Al(OH)3precipitation were measured under different experiment conditions including pH,concentration,temperature and aging time.aluminum removal efficiency can reach 97% in experiment indicating that direct application of hydrolysis method in aluminum removal from the leaching solution is feasible.Compared with extraction method,hydrolysis method provides several advantages,such as simple process,no demand of additional facilities and low cost;thus holds great promise for industrial application.
